TiVo Offering Access To Youtube Video
The creator of and a leader in television services for digital video recorders (DVRs), TiVo has recently announced that its subscribers will be able to access YouTube videos directly from their TV sets via a TiVo DVR, aiming to enhance your Youtube experience.

“We’re delighted to be working with the world’s leading online video community so that TiVo subscribers can access YouTube’s popular content on the TV via the TiVo DVR,” said Tara Maitra, Vice President and GM of Content Services at TiVo Inc. “Being able to make available YouTube videos to the TiVo subscriber base using one device, one remote and one user interface is another major step in our commitment to combine all of your television and web video viewing options in one easy to use service.”
According to the company, this cool service will be available later this year to broadband-connected subscribers with TiVo Series 3 DVRs including the new TiVo HD.
